Outer Rhythm was a highly respected label during it's short lifespan that lasted shortly over three years. Many of the labels releases were licensed tracks from the U.S.A. and Belgium and gave increased visibility to Moby ("Go") and R&S records who had an exclusive pressing & distribution deal which turned many of its artists into recognized & established talents. The deal itself would be for a short period but gave new life to records by Joey Beltram, Outlander & Human Resource
being offered for the first time as a U.K. release. As for Outer Rhythm itself all of the label catalog are still highly praised treasures even 12 years after they closed doors. There was a label that was born out of Outer Rhythm and that label still exists. Warp Records first releases all had "In association with Outer Rhythm"
and the logo printed on them. Warp #6 still had that imprint, but soonafter Warp went seperate ways. And Warp continues its own legacy while Outer Rhythm soon disbanded shortly after that split. However many
of Outer Rhythm's catalog is Archive Grade Material.

Outer Rhythm may have best been known as the label that licenced and released R&S Records to the UK. Check the R&S Records discog for the Outer Rhythm releases (Look for the catalogue numbers in this style: RSUK000).
